Page MenuHomeElementl

[dagit] Fix stdout/stderr log view

Authored by dish on Mon, Jun 7, 6:50 PM.



Resolves #4254.

When viewing the stdout/stderr option in Run logs, the step selector doesn't set the selected value correctly. Links from the logs themselves also do not navigate to the correct step. Fix this by tracking logKey in the URL query. This allows us to link directly to the view of that log key in the log item itself, and repairs the select element.

Test Plan

View a run. Click to stdout view, change selected step. Verify that the select updates properly, the URL updates properly, and the stdout/stderr is correct.

Click a "View stdout/stderr" link on a log item. Verify that it goes to the correct log key in the stdout view.

Reload the page with query param set, verify that it loads the stdout view correctly.

Diff Detail

R1 dagster
Lint Not Applicable
Tests Not Applicable

Event Timeline

dish requested review of this revision.Mon, Jun 7, 7:01 PM
This revision is now accepted and ready to land.Tue, Jun 8, 3:55 PM
This revision was automatically updated to reflect the committed changes.